Should Ahmadis join an army to increase the influence of Ahmadiyyat in a country?

Huzoor (rh): No, no, there is no point in doing that, not at all. In fact, this is wrong. Jama’at-e-Ahmadiyya teaches obedience to the law and obedience to the employer. The purpose of that army is not to increase influence, your personal or religious influence. That is wrong in principle. So no Ahmadi boy would ever do that or he will not be acting righteously according to the Ahmadi standards of morality. So it’s out of question.
